Solar Panel Innovation Basics
To truly grasp the essence of photovoltaic panel innovation, you should look into the essential concepts that underpin its capability. Solar panels include photovoltaic cells, usually made from silicon, which have the impressive capability to convert sunshine into electrical energy through the photovoltaic result. When sunshine strikes the cells, the photons in the light interact with the silicon atoms, creating the electrons to break without their atomic bonds. This creates an electric current that can after that be taken advantage of for powering various devices.
The essential component of solar panels is the semiconductors within the photovoltaic cells, which facilitate the conversion of sunlight into functional power. These semiconductors have both favorable and negative layers, producing an electrical field that allows for the flow of electrons.
This flow of electrons, when linked in a circuit, produces straight existing (DC) electricity. Comprehending these fundamental principles is vital for appreciating just how photovoltaic panels can harness the sun's power to power homes, businesses, and even satellites in space.
Exactly How Solar Panels Generate Electrical Energy
Solar panels harness the sun's energy by transforming sunlight right into electricity through a process referred to as the solar effect. When sunshine strikes the photovoltaic panels, the photons (light particles) are taken in by the semiconducting products within the panels, typically constructed from silicon. This absorption creates an electric present as the photons knock electrons loosened from the atoms within the product.
The electric fields within the solar cells then force these electrons to move in a particular direction, developing a direct existing (DC) of electrical power. This direct current is after that passed through an inverter, which converts it into alternating current (AIR CONDITIONER) electrical energy that can be utilized to power your home or organization.
Excess electricity generated by the photovoltaic panels can be stored in batteries for later use or fed back into the grid for credit score with a process called web metering. Comprehending Photovoltaic Panel Parts
One crucial aspect of photovoltaic panel technology is recognizing the different components that comprise a solar panel system.
The essential parts of a photovoltaic panel system include the solar panels themselves, which are made up of photovoltaic cells that convert sunshine right into power. These panels are mounted on a framework, commonly a roofing system, to capture sunlight.
In addition to the panels, there are inverters that transform the direct present (DC) electricity created by the panels into alternating existing (A/C) electrical power that can be used in homes or organizations.
